Lymnaea

1

Lymnaea is a genus of small to large-sized air-breathing freshwater snails, aquatic pulmonate gastropod mollusks in the subfamily Lymnaeinae ( of the family Lymnaeidae, the pond snails. Some species are used in aquaculture under the name Melantho snails. Numerous Lymnaea species serve as intermediate hosts for trematodes. Lymnaea is the type genus of the family Lymnaeidae.
